✨Valentine’s Day Bingo Game Instructions
This is really just like the classic game of bingo as for how the rules go. But instead of numbers there are pictures and words to make it a fun activity for Valentine’s day, like hearts, cupid, and a teddy bear. But just in case you need a little refresher, here’s a quick rundown on what to do.
Set Up
- Assign a player to be the bingo caller.
- Give each player a bingo card and 25 bingo markers.
- Shuffle the calling cards (if you are using the large cutouts).
- Determine which winning variation below you will play by.
How to Play
The caller will name an object. If any player has the object on their card, they should cover it with a marker. Place the card to the side or mark off the object on the full calling sheet.
Continuing calling cards until the first player shouts, “BINGO”! This may require reshuffling the cards and going back through them unless you print extra copies.
How to Win Bingo
There are a few variations of how to win Bingo.
- Traditional Bingo– any combination of 5 objects. This can be vertical, horizontal, or diagonal.
- Full card – all squares on the card must be covered to win.
- Four corners – each of the corners have to be covered.
- Outer borders – only the borders of the card will be covered.
What Happens Next?
After the first person wins bingo, you have two options. Have guests clear their cards and start over for a new game or continue playing, leaving their markers where they are. Older kids normally like a little bit of a challenge, so we recommend them clearing their cards.
Since their are 60 unique bingo cards included, you can always have them use different bingo cards for each round.

💡Helpful Tips
- If you didn’t want to use the printable markers, you could use dot markers or conversation hearts (or whatever other game pieces you may have on hand).
- If you want a more professional look or if you want the game to look a little prettier, use heavy white card stock. The paper weight will vary, but as a reference regular copy paper is about 20lbs.
- Check your printer settings before starting for best results. No printer? Local print shops can help, and they are usually reasonably priced or you can check an online print shop.
- Laminating the printable cards is a great way to make them last longer. Then instead of using the paper markers, you can use dry erase markers.
- Add to call sheet or a page protector and mark off with dry erase markers so you don’t have to print multiples.
